Try Oracle's UltraSearch instead. It does exactly what you're looking = for. On a test P-IV 2.4Ghz w/512MB of mem, an UltraSearch indexing of a = 65+K page intranet website returns results in about a second for a few = users. And it correctly indexed Wurd, Exhell, and all other types of MS = docs. It even pulled in the headers of an MPEG!
